Earth is Our Home Writing Contest: results

As part of the Children’s Film Charity Festival in Luxembourg, students of the Kalinka Russian School took part in the Earth is Our Home Writing Contest.

8-15 year olds answered the following questions in their essays:

  • What will our planet look like in 100 years?
  • What, in your opinion, are the major threats to the environment nowadays?
  • What are your suggestions for steps we might consider to improve the environmen?
  • What have you already done to improve the environment?

The Kalinka Russian School held ecology lessons, where the students could write their essays.
